> R-Car DU changes for v5.3:
>
> - R8A774A1 SoC support
> - LVDS dual-link mode support
> - Support for additional formats
> - Misc fixes
I wasn't quite sure whether this has enough dt-acks, but I guess one r-b
from Rob on the main dt patch should be enough. And everything else looks
very neatly reviewed!
Thanks, pulled.
